With extensive experience within the dive industry, your professional staff and instructional team at Pura Vida Divers values your comfort, safety, enjoyment, and achievement.
Dean Shuler
President
Captain, PADI Master Scuba Diver Trainer
Born and raised in Griffin, Georgia, Dean studied marine zoology while pursuing a career in diving. After 6 years of extensive experience within the dive industry including managing charter operations at a highly-rated dive operation and teaching at a PADI Career Development Center, he developed and opened Pura Vida Divers. In addition to his role as President, he is an accomplished United States Coast Guard-licensed 100 Ton Captain, PADI Master Scuba Diver Trainer, Emergency First Response Instructor, DAN O2 Provider Instructor, and TDI Instructor. On his "off" days he enjoys diving the springs, caverns and cave systems in North Florida and Mexico. His favorite dive sites include Atlantis and Paul's Reef.Kevin Cox

Originally from Columbus, Indiana, Shana graduated from the College of Charleston in South Carolina with Marine Biology and Environmental Science Degrees. After initially moving to Florida to pursue a career in diving she returned to the Carolinas where she completed her Masters Degree in Coastal Environmental Management at Duke University's Nicholas School of the Environment. She has worked with the Juno Marine Life Center as a Marine Biologist and Researcher studying endangered and threatened sea turtles including the elusive Leatherback. In 2002, she was interviewed by The Discovery Channel in regards to her research, and in 2005 she worked closely with WIDECAST to create a Sea Turtle Stranding Field Guide. She returned to Pura Vida in 2005 as Dive Facility Manager. In addition, Shana is a PADI Master Scuba Diver Trainer and TDI Instructor.
